Brits love a bit of fancy dress!

Stylist Mark Heyes has revealed how to recreate this year’s trending fancy dress looks for less, as research shows dressing up has become a national obsession.

A poll of 2,000 adults revealed 43 per cent of Brits claim to have more fun when in fancy dress, while 38 per cent believe the UK has become a land obsessed with the art of dress up.

According to celebrity stylist Mark Heyes, this year’s standout fancy dress looks are being shaped by the cultural moments dominating our screens and social feeds.
